How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to San Bernardino Damage Experts initiates rapid deployment. We gather crucial details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team immediately. Our 24/7 service is ready.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all water damage. This comprehensive assessment guides our restoration strategy, ensuring no hidden moisture remains.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ial extractors remove standing water quickly. This critical step prevents further saturation and reduces drying time, preparing the area for thorough dehumidification and sanitization.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ers dry affected structures and contents. We monitor humidity levels daily, preventing mold growth and preserving your property's integrity.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ated areas are thoroughly cleaned, disinfected, and deodorized using EPA-approved solutions. This eliminates bacteria and odors,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you.
6
Final Inspection
A meticulous final inspection confirms complete dryness and restoration. We walk you through the restored areas, ensuring your satisfaction with our work. Your property is ready.

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Flooding in a small, contained area (e.g., a single room) Yes No You can likely handle the cleanup and water removal yourself with the right equipment and knowledge.
Flooding in a large, complex area (e.g., a warehouse or commercial building) No Yes This type of flooding needs specialized equipment, expertise, and a thorough drying process to prevent secondary damage.
Unknown or hidden water damage No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. A professional inspection and remediation are necessary to ensure the problem is fully addressed.
Water damage affecting electrical systems or critical infrastructure No Yes Electrical systems and critical infrastructure need specialized handling and expertise to prevent damage and ensure safety.
Water damage that's spreading or worsening No Yes Don't wait - call us immediately to schedule a professional inspection and remediation to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.
Water damage that needs specialized equipment or expertise (e.g., sewage backups, water damage in sensitive areas) No Yes These types of water damage need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.

Commercial Water Removal Cost In Azusa, CA

The cost of commercial water removal in Azusa, CA,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on national averages and may not reflect the actual cost of your specific job. Our team will provide a personalized estimate after assessing the damage and providing a solution.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Drying Protocol $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Disinfection and S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Emergency Response $500 - $2,000 Time of day, severity of damage, equipment needed
Equipment Rental $500 - $2,000 Type of equipment needed, rental duration

Is commercial water removal covered by insurance?

Yes, commercial water removal is often covered by insurance policies. But, the specifics of your policy and the extent of coverage will depend on your individual circumstances. Our team will work with you and your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?

To prevent water damage in the future, it's essential to regularly inspect your property for signs of water damage, leaks, or potential issues. You should also ensure that your plumbing systems are properly maintained, and your employees are trained to handle water-related emergencies. Also, consider investing in a water damage prevention system, such as a flood sensor or a water leak detector.
